(LOCATED) Concern for Missing 66-Year-Old Man with Dementia

For Immediate Release: Friday, June 18, 2021

Update: June 18 at 8:30 p.m. - Eugene Rodgers has been located safe and unharmed. 

Detectives with the Montgomery County Department of Police are asking for the public’s assistance in locating a missing 66-year-old man from downtown Silver Spring who has dementia.

Eugene Rodgers was last seen at approximately 4:00 p.m. yesterday (Thursday, June 17) when he left his Fenwick Lane residence on foot.  At that time, Rodgers stated to friends that he was running an errand to a nearby store and that he would return soon.  Friends and family have been unable to contact him since he left his home.

Rodgers is approximately 5’ 6” tall and weighs 130 pounds.  He is bald and has brown eyes. Rodgers was last seen wearing a white T-shirt and blue jeans.

Police and family are concerned for Rodgers’ welfare.

Anyone with information regarding Eugene Rodgers’ whereabouts is asked to call 9-1-1.
